**香港云服务器微服务通信的革新与实践**,在云计算和大数据时代,香港的云服务器微服务通信技术取得了显著进步,通过引入容器化、Kubernetes等先进技术,云服务器实现了微服务架构的灵活部署与管理,这种革新不仅提高了系统的可靠性和可扩展性,还大幅降低了运维成本,实践中,我们采用了一系列优化措施,如负载均衡、自动化运维工具,确保微服务通信的高效稳定,这些创新举措为香港的数字化建设注入了新的活力。
随着云计算技术的迅猛发展,云服务器作为其重要组成部分,在金融、电商、游戏等众多行业中扮演着关键角色,而微服务架构以其高效、灵活的特点正逐渐成为企业数字化转型的首选,在这背景下,香港云服务器微服务通信的实现与优化显得尤为重要。
云服务器微服务架构概述
微服务架构是一种将单一应用程序划分成一组小的服务,每个服务运行在其独立的进程中,并通过轻量级机制(如HTTP RESTful API)进行通信,在香港这样的国际化都市,利用高效的云服务器微服务通信技术可以确保企业在全球范围内的业务实时响应和数据处理。
香港云服务器微服务通信的关键技术
-
容器化技术:Docker等容器技术能够为微服务提供一致的运行环境,简化部署和管理流程。
-
服务网格:如Istio或Linkerd等服务网格工具,可以提供更为细粒度的流量控制、安全策略实施以及可观察性保障。
-
API网关:统一的API网关负责请求路由、协议转换和认证授权等任务,简化客户端与服务间的交互。
-
消息队列:Kafka或RabbitMQ等消息队列实现服务间的异步通信和解耦,提升系统的灵活性和可扩展性。
香港云服务器微服务通信的最佳实践
-
服务拆分与治理:基于业务功能合理拆分微服务,并构建统一的服务注册中心、配置中心以及监控中心,以支撑服务的治理与运维。
-
安全性考量:采用HTTPS加密通信、API密钥及访问控制列表(ACL)等措施保护数据安全,并利用日志审计和入侵检测系统预防潜在威胁。
-
性能优化策略:通过缓存机制减少数据库负载,使用负载均衡分散请求压力,并考虑采用服务端渲染与CDN加速内容分发,提升用户体验和响应速度。
-
自动化运维:借助于CI/CD工具如Jenkins实现自动化构建、测试和部署流程,提高开发和运维效率的同时确保软件质量的稳定性。
香港作为国际金融中心和科技创新的前沿阵地,对云服务器微服务通信技术提出了更高的要求,本文针对香港地区的特点和需求,探讨了实现高效稳定云服务器微服务通信的有效路径和实践经验分享。